ONE Championship has its eyes on Manny Pacquiao

With an agreement signed with the flyweight champion, Srisaket Sor Rungvisai, the organization focuses on signing the Filipino boxing legend

M. Pacquiao (photo) was the first linear champion in boxing history in five different weight categories. Photo: Reproduction/Instagram @mannypacquiao

Asia's premier MMA organization, ONE Championship is looking to expand its brand into boxing. President, Chatri Sityodtong recently announced the signing of Thailand's WBC flyweight world champion, Srisaket Sor Rungvisai. Now the event seeks to close a deal with boxing legend Manny Pacquiao.

“I would love to see him defend his title in the Philippines and give the Filipino fans what they want on a mega card. Manny, let's do this. We could bring together all the heroes of the Philippines in one mega event and blow it up to the whole world. What we want to showcase is all combat sports, and we want to have multiple division champions across all disciplines. We want to give Filipino fans what they want,” Sityodtong said.

Since Pacquiao's superfight with Floyd Mayweather Jr. in 2015, the Filipina has had four fights, with three wins and a controversial loss to Jeff Horn in July last year in Australia.

At 39 years old, 'Pacman' has been fighting professional boxing for 23 years and does not intend to retire at the moment. Pacquiao has a record of 68 fights, with 60 wins and seven losses.
